OpenWRT x86平台上V2Ray配置指南

目录

前言

OpenWRT是一款功能强大的开源路由器固件,广受好评。在OpenWRT系统上配置V2Ray作为代理服务,可以实现全局科学上网,为用户提供稳定可靠的翻墙服务。本文将详细介绍如何在OpenWRT x86平台上安装和配置V2Ray,希望对有需要的用户有所帮助。

环境准备

  • 已安装OpenWRT x86版本的路由器设备
  • 一个可用的V2Ray服务器节点,包括服务器地址、端口、UUID等信息

安装V2Ray

  1. 登录OpenWRT路由器的管理页面
  2. 进入 系统 > 软件包 菜单
  3. 在搜索框中输入 v2ray 并搜索
  4. 找到 v2ray-core 软件包,点击 安装 开始安装
  5. 等待安装完成即可

配置V2Ray

客户端配置

  1. 登录OpenWRT路由器的管理页面
  2. 进入 网络 > V2Ray 菜单
  3. 客户端配置 选项卡中,填写以下信息:
    • 服务器地址: 您的V2Ray服务器地址
    • 服务器端口: 您的V2Ray服务器端口
    • 用户ID(UUID): 您的V2Ray用户ID
    • 额外ID: 0 (可选)
    • 用户level: 0 (可选)
    • 传输协议: 根据您的服务器配置选择合适的协议,常见的有 tcpws
    • 伪装类型: 根据您的服务器配置选择合适的伪装类型,常见的有 nonehttp
    • 伪装域名: 如果您选择 ws 传输协议,需要填写伪装域名
  4. 点击 保存并应用 按钮保存配置

服务端配置

服务端配置需要在您的V2Ray服务器上进行,具体步骤如下:

  1. 登录您的V2Ray服务器
  2. 编辑V2Ray的配置文件,一般位于 /etc/v2ray/config.json
  3. 根据您的需求,配置以下字段:
    • port: 服务器监听端口
    • uuid: 用户ID
    • alterId: 额外ID
    • security: 加密方式,常见的有 autoaes-128-gcmchacha20-poly1305
    • network: 传输协议,常见的有 tcpwskcp
    • wsSettings: 如果使用 ws 协议,需要配置伪装路径和域名
  4. 保存配置文件并重启V2Ray服务

启动V2Ray

  1. 登录OpenWRT路由器的管理页面
  2. 进入 网络 > V2Ray 菜单
  3. 服务状态 选项卡中,点击 启动 按钮启动V2Ray服务
  4. 如果一切正常,您应该能看到 V2Ray服务已启动 的提示

常见问题解答

如何查看V2Ray日志?

登录OpenWRT路由器的SSH终端,运行以下命令查看V2Ray日志:

logread | grep v2ray

如何更新V2Ray版本?

  1. 登录OpenWRT路由器的管理页面
  2. 进入 系统 > 软件包 菜单
  3. 在搜索框中输入 v2ray 并搜索
  4. 找到 v2ray-core 软件包,点击 更新 按钮即可

V2Ray连接失败怎么办?

出现连接失败的常见原因包括:

  • 检查服务器地址、端口、UUID等配置信息是否正确
  • 检查服务器防火墙是否开放了相应的端口
  • 尝试更换其他传输协议或伪装类型
  • 查看V2Ray日志排查错误信息

如果以上步骤无法解决,建议您联系V2Ray服务提供商寻求帮助。

正文完